    Golgo 13 (Sonny Chiba) is a callous, calculating assassin working for a violent U.S. drug syndicate who’s in Hong Kong to carry out his latest mission: murdering the most powerful gangster in the city. The only thing standing in Golgo’s way is a dogged detective (Callan Leung) who’s determined to stop the killer at any cost. This stylish, hard-boiled action thriller from Yukio Noda is based on the best-selling manga comic book.Read More »
